Despite rift, Vijay's father offered prayers before counting began

ADVERTISEMENT

SA Chandrasekhar, the veteran filmmaker and Thalapathy Vijay's father, today visited the Tiruttani Murugan Temple just before the counting of results began. He performed special pujas for his son. Vijay is the chief of the Tamilaga Vettri Kazhagam party, which is likely coming to power on its own in Tamil Nadu. At the time of writing, it is the single largest party and is not through the half-way mark yet.

Chandrasekhar prayed for the success of his son’s political debut. This spiritual gesture has drawn the media's attention. The father and son were perceived to have serious differences for many years. Their public relationship remained strained over political and personal issues.

A few years ago, without Vijay's consent, his father registered a political party called the All India Thalapathy Vijay Makkal Iyakkam with the Election Commission. The Jana Nayagan actor responded by filing a legal case against 11 people, including his own parents.

Vijay also visited temples in Tiruchendur and Shirdi recently, besides a few churches.
